As Google bait for others who might become stuck as I did, if you have problems with Tar2RubyScript on Mac OS X, with an error message like this:
Creating application_darwin ...
/sw/lib/ruby/1.8/ftools.rb:18:in `stat': No such file or directory -
/tmp/tar2rubyscript.d.999.1/rubyscript2exe/eee_darwin (Errno::ENOENT)
from /sw/lib/ruby/1.8/ftools.rb:18:in `syscopy'
from /sw/lib/ruby/1.8/ftools.rb:43:in `copy'
from /private/tmp/tar2rubyscript.d.999.1/rubyscript2exe/init.rb:217
from /Users/jbrains/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e.rb:556:in `load'
from /Users/jbrains/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e.rb:556
from /Users/jbrains/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e.rb:551:in `newlocation'
from /Users/jbrains/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e.rb:521:in `newlocation'
from /Users/jbrains/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e.rb:457:in `newlocation'
from /Users/jbrains/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e.rb:457:in `newlocation'
from /Users/jbrains/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e.rb:521:in `newlocation'
from /Users/jbrains/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e.rb:565
You need to manually add the file eee_darwin (the one you compiled with FreePascal) into the rubyscript2exe package itself. That's what Erik means by "Copy eee_darwin to rubyscript2exe/" in his instructions. I did this:
stuart:~/Workspaces/general/DistributedRubyExperiments jbrains$ cd ~/Library/Ruby/ stuart:~/Library/Ruby jbrains$ ls eee_darwin rubyscript2exe.rb tar2rubyscript-0.4.5.rb stuart:~/Library/Ruby jbrains$ ruby rubyscript2exe.rb --tar2rubyscript-totar stuart:~/Library/Ruby jbrains$ ls eee_darwin rubyscript2exe.rb rubyscript2exe.tar tar2rubyscript-0.4.5.rb stuart:~/Library/Ruby jbrains$ tar xf rubyscript2exe.tar stuart:~/Library/Ruby jbrains$ ls eee_darwin rubyscript2exe.rb tar2rubyscript-0.4.5.rb rubyscript2exe rubyscript2exe.tar stuart:~/Library/Ruby jbrains$ cd rubyscript2exe stuart:~/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e jbrains$ ls LICENSE VERSION eee.pas eeew.exe require2lib.rb README eee.exe eee.rc ev SUMMARY eee.ico eee_linux init.rb stuart:~/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e jbrains$ cp ../eee_darwin . stuart:~/Library/Ruby/rubyscript2exe jbrains$ cd .. stuart:~/Library/Ruby jbrains$ mv rubyscript2exe.rb rubyscript2exe.rb.old stuart:~/Library/Ruby jbrains$ tar cf rubyscript2exe.tar rubyscript2exe stuart:~/Library/Ruby jbrains$ ruby tar2rubyscript-0.4.5.rb rubyscript2exe.tar Creating archive... Creating rubyscript2exe.rb ...And then I could use
rubyscript2exe, complete with Erik's experimental Mac OS X support. (Works so far!) I hope this helps save someone a little bit of time.
